tests/md5sum.py
changeset 52640 24ee91ba9aa8
parent 48875 6000f5b25c9b
--- a/tests/md5sum.py	Mon Jan 06 14:15:40 2025 -0500
+++ b/tests/md5sum.py	Sun Jan 05 21:03:17 2025 -0500
@@ -22,7 +22,7 @@
 for filename in sys.argv[1:]:
     try:
         fp = open(filename, 'rb')
-    except IOError as msg:
+    except OSError as msg:
         sys.stderr.write('%s: Can\'t open: %s\n' % (filename, msg))
         sys.exit(1)
 
@@ -30,7 +30,7 @@
     try:
         for data in iter(lambda: fp.read(8192), b''):
             m.update(data)
-    except IOError as msg:
+    except OSError as msg:
         sys.stderr.write('%s: I/O error: %s\n' % (filename, msg))
         sys.exit(1)
     sys.stdout.write('%s  %s\n' % (m.hexdigest(), filename))